Our structured deployment path.

We design and deploy your integration in structured phases, ensuring your internal systems align with your external partners' technical capabilities before we write any mapping rules.

1
Phase 1

Discovery & architecture design

We audit your internal databases, identify manual CSV bottlenecks, and design the technical connection model—whether point-to-point, hub-and-spoke, or API-led.

Internal database auditConnection model designData standard selection (X12, JSON)Security layer configuration
2
Phase 2

Platform selection & translation mapping

We calculate the total cost of ownership for competing middleware options, then build the transformation pipelines and EDI mapping sheets for your core transaction sets.

TCO tool evaluation matrixEDI 850/856/810 mapping sheetsAPI endpoint configurationTransformation pipeline build
3
Phase 3

Joint testing & partner validation

We run end-to-end sandbox testing alongside your external partners' IT departments, executing negative testing scenarios to verify how the system handles failed messages.

Sandbox end-to-end testingNegative testing scenariosFailover verificationTransaction acknowledgment logs
4
Phase 4

Production launch & team handover

We transition your pipelines live with active data syncs, monitor transactions during a hypercare phase, and hand over operational SOPs to your team.

EDI (Electronic Data Interchange) integration is the automated, computer-to-computer exchange of standard business documents between trading partners. For distributors, it eliminates manual order entry, reduces transcription errors, and accelerates the order-to-shipment cycle by directly connecting partner purchase orders to your internal ERP or warehouse management system.
